Cheapest Available Fullerton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Fullerton area of Allentown, PA is a Studio unit found at Franklin Park priced from $1,200. Mickley Run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,255. Here are the most affordable Fullerton apartments for rent in Allentown, PA:

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Fullerton Apartments

What is a cheap apartment in Fullerton?

A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Fullerton is under $1,775.

What is the price of a cheap apartment in Fullerton?

The cheapest apartment in Fullerton is Mickley Run Apartments which is listed at $1,255, while the average apartment in Fullerton costs $2,300.

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Fullerton?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 3 regular apartments in Fullerton that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
